We are looking for a Studio Manager to manage the day-to-day operations of our design studio, ensure smooth workflow, coordinate between teams, and make sure all project submissions are delivered on time with high quality.
Experience Required: 2–5 years in Design/Architecture/Project Coordination
This role requires strong organizational skills, communication skills, and leadership qualities.
Key Responsibilities
1. Workflow and Project Management
- Create and maintain project schedules and timelines.
- Assign tasks to the design, visualization, and drafting teams.
- Track daily progress and ensure timely submissions.
2. Team Coordination
- Act as the communication link between:
- Design Teams
- Client Coordinators
- Sales Team
- Estimation Team
- Project Execution Team
- Schedule and manage internal & client meetings.
3. Daily Studio Operations
- Conduct daily morning task planning and evening review meetings.
- Ensure task updates and project stages are logged in ERP/software.
- Maintain discipline, attendance tracking, and leave handover process.
4. Documentation & Reporting
- Maintain and organize digital and physical project files.
- Record meeting minutes and share them with the respective teams.
- Update client groups & reports on project progress.
